On episode 21 of SOMEWHERE IN THE SKIES, Ryan leaves his home of New York City for a cross-country move to Los Angeles, reflecting on his decade-long residence in the city that never sleeps. He then introduces listeners to his new Patreon Campaign! He is then joined by Jason McClellan for an "in studio" conversation about UFOs, the paranormal, and belief systems v.s. hard science. It was a fascinating discussion as the two cracked open a few Harpoon UFO Beers in Jason's Times Square hotel room in Manhattan. They also talk about their awkward run ins with both Gillian Anderson and David Duchovny! He is also the web content manager and staff writer for OpenMinds.tv, and a co-organizer and technical producer of the International UFO Congress. As a founding member of Open Minds, Jason served as a writer and editor for the now defunct Open Minds magazine. He has appeared on Syfy, NatGeo, and, most recently, he co-starred on H2’s Hangar 1: The UFO Files.
